Neurofibromatosis is a genetic disorder characterized by the growth of tumors on nerves and can lead to various neurological issues. It primarily presents in two forms: Neurofibromatosis Type 1 (NF1) and Neurofibromatosis Type 2 (NF2). Both types have distinct characteristics, symptoms, and management strategies. Understanding these differences is essential for effective diagnosis, support, and treatment.
### Neurofibromatosis Type 1 (NF1)
Neurofibromatosis Type 1 is the most common form of neurofibromatosis, affecting approximately 1 in 3,000 people worldwide. NF1 is caused by mutations in the NF1 gene, which plays a role in regulating cell growth. One of the hallmark signs of NF1 is the presence of café-au-lait spots, which are flat, pigmented skin lesions. Additionally, individuals with NF1 may develop neurofibromas, benign tumors that grow on nerves, and plexiform neurofibromas, which are more complex and can be more invasive. Other symptoms may include learning disabilities, attention deficit hyperactivity disorder (ADHD), and various skeletal abnormalities. Early identification and monitoring are crucial to manage symptoms and complications effectively.
### Neurofibromatosis Type 2 (NF2)
Neurofibromatosis Type 2 is less common than NF1, with an estimated prevalence of 1 in 25,000 people. NF2 is associated with mutations in the NF2 gene, leading to the development of bilateral vestibular schwannomas, also known as acoustic neuromas. These benign tumors grow on the vestibular nerve, which is responsible for balance and hearing. Symptoms of NF2 often include hearing loss, tinnitus (ringing in the ears), and balance issues. Unlike NF1, NF2 typically does not present with café-au-lait spots or neurofibromas. Due to the risk of hearing loss and other neurological complications, ongoing monitoring and treatment for individuals with NF2 are necessary to mitigate symptoms and improve quality of life.
### Impact on Learning and Development
Both NF1 and NF2 can significantly impact learning and cognitive development, especially in children. Due to the nature of the disorders, children with NF1 may face challenges such as learning disabilities, difficulties with attention, and social skills deficits. These challenges can result from the neurological changes associated with the disorder as well as the psychological impact of living with a chronic condition. Early intervention and tailored educational support can help address these challenges, enabling children with NF1 to reach their academic potential.
### Support and Management
The management of neurofibromatosis involves a multidisciplinary approach that includes regular monitoring for tumor development, early intervention for learning difficulties, and psychological support. Individuals with NF1 often benefit from educational accommodations, such as modified teaching methods and special education services, to help them succeed in school. For those with NF2, routine imaging may be necessary to monitor for tumor growth, and surgical options may be considered to address significant symptoms like hearing loss. Support groups and resources are also essential in helping individuals and families cope with the emotional and practical aspects of living with neurofibromatosis.
